Practical Steps to Declutter



Decluttering is a necessary action towards attaining a minimalist way of living and calls for a methodical approach. Begin by setting clear objectives for the decluttering procedure. Determine which locations of your lifeâEUR" be it your home, workspace, or digital spaceâEUR" require interest initially.


Next, employ the "one in, one out" guideline to maintain equilibrium as you declutter. For every single new product that enters your life, consider eliminating an existing one. This principle aids in preventing future clutter buildup.


Take on the four-box technique: label boxes as "keep," "give away," "offer," and "garbage." As you arrange via each product, place it in the proper box. This approach not just streamlines decision-making but also provides a visual representation of your development.


Dedicate and set a timer to brief, concentrated decluttering sessions. Also 15 to 30 mins can yield considerable results without causing overwhelm. Establish a routine upkeep routine to keep mess at bay. By integrating these useful steps right into your way of living, you can develop an organized setting that promotes quality and purpose, strengthening the core values of minimalism.
